oracle中pga使用分析

show parameterspga; 。此表使用oracle -1的内存区域/(可以手动调试pga)的大小 , 如果它超过了pga的大小,您将使用临时表空间作为磁盘上的虚拟内存(页面更改等),oracleSGA,如何查看oracle11g log分析如何查看oraclecurrentpga这是数据库中可以使用的总大?。瑂electsum (pga _你可以大致查看一下当前pga占用的大小 。
1、 oracle在存储过程中动态的建一个临时表使用和在数据库里写死一个临时...在存储过程中动态创建临时表就是创建所谓的globaltemporarytable,也就是内存表 。此表使用oracle -1的内存区域/(可以手动调试pga)的大小 。如果它超过了pga的大小,您将使用临时表空间作为磁盘上的虚拟内存(页面更改等) 。在内存允许的范围内,内存操作的数量级是磁盘的几千倍 。因此 , 临时表比写入永久表空间的表快n倍 。
我们还是用实验05的环境,省略了准备数据的过程 。我们还是用两个会话,一个是run,用来运行主SQL;另一个会话ps用于观察performance_schema:主会话线程号为29 , performance_schema中的统计值被重置 。临时表的表大小限制取决于参数tmp_table_size和max_heap_table_size中较小的一个 。在我们的实验中 , 我们以设置max_heap_table_size为例 。
2、 oracleSGA,PGA内存分配,急...【oracle中pga使用分析】9I好像没有自动内存管理和SGA_TARGET 。增加您的SGA最大大?。缓笤黾庸蚕沓卮笮?。好像2G内存有点小 。另外,最好不要在系统中做其他消耗资源的操作 。空间满了可以给他添加数据文件,或者在建空间的时候设置为autoextendON 。1oralce10g启动SGA,PGA的内存分配是自动的 。
您唯一要做的事情就是为整个实例分配多少内存 。你的原因可能是你的oracle正在运行 , 其中总内存已经分配给每个进程了 。你是在给定总内存的前提下分配的 。也就是“拆东墙补西墙” 。所以我建议你内存不够 。应该通过SGA _目标参数为此实例设置SGA可用的总内存容量 。那你就不用担心-0里面的具体分配了/它会自动管理的 。2查看您将哪个表空间导入到表中 。
3、Oracle专用服务器的内存结构分布原则一般我们会使用oracle instance的内存到系统物理内存的80% 60%(4G以上内存使用到80%,2G内存使用到60% 70%)Spga SGA _ Max _ size 80%内存(对于OLTP系统,如果是DSS,可以50/50共享)Db _ cache _ size 60% SGA shared _ pool _ size SGA _ max _ size b _ cache _ size 160m也可以设置为35%左右SGA Java _ pool _ size 64m large _ pool _ size 16 mlog _ buffer 2 m1:4g如果物理内存为4000m , 则s3200m用于o . LTP(SGAS * 80% 2560 MDB _ cache _ size 1536m)shared _ pool _ size 864m放置sql、plsql代码(中
4、Oracle数据库LogMiner工具的使用方法Logminer(DBMS_LOGMNR和DBMS_LOGMNR_D)包可用于分析Oracle的重做日志文件Logminer是oracle我们可以使用logminer 分析其他实例(具有不同版本)的重做日志文件必须符合以下要求:LogMiner Log 分析 Tools只能要使用logminer安装LogMiner , 必须首先运行以下两个脚本:$ Oracle _ home/RDBMS/admin/dbmslmsql $ Oracle _ home/RDBMS/admin/这两个dbmslmdsql脚本都必须作为SYS用户运行,以创建数据字典文件 。首先,将参数UTL_添加到initora初始化参数文件中,参数值是将数据放入服务器中 。
5、如何对 oracle11g日志 分析 6、如何查看 oracle当前 pga的大小这是数据库的总大?。?select sum(PGA _ alloc _ mem)/1024/1024/1024 gfromv $ process;可以大致查一下目前pga占用的大小 。show parameterspga; 。在命令行用sqlplus/assysdba登录数据库 , 然后输入showparameter pga,回车,就可以查到当前数据库的pga的大小 。
7、 oracle10gsga和 pga怎么配置是通过改变相关参数来修改的,但是sga和pga都包含多个组件,尤其是sga 。如果要配置它们,首先要熟悉sga和pga的结构,如果不熟悉,建议采用默认值 。而且10g中sga的调整主要采用自动共享内存管理(ASSM)的方式,不需要你做太多的设置 。

    推荐阅读